CHARLATANS POLAR BEAR UNRELEASED - unreleased and possibly the only known copy of the 12" test pressing for Then (SIT 74TA) that includes the track "Polar Bear". This was scrapped prior to release as XXXX did not want it on there and it was replaced with Taurus Moaner. Lot also includes an unreleased 7" single test pressing of I Never Want An Easy Life If Me And He Were Ever To Get There (BBQ31).

1921 Republic of Ireland Thirty Dollar Bond 15 November 1921, numbered 421, issued to Patrick Aylward, with printed signature of President de Valera. Scarce denomination. 6 by 8.25in. (15.2 by 21cm) The bond was to bear 5% interest per annum "from the first day of the seventh month after the freeing of the territory of the Republic of Ireland from Britain's military control". Controversy arose after de Valera refused to hand over the funds to the Provisional Government; a compromise was reached and much of the funds went to found the Irish Press newspaper, effectively under the controlling ownership of the de Valera family.
